The Benefits of Attending a Daycare Center as an Infant or Toddler

Rest assured, knowing your children are developing different skills and learning daily from peers at your local daycare center in Downingtown, PA. Enrolling infants and toddlers in a child care center offers numerous benefits, including social and emotional development, independent skill improvement, and health habits. 


Developing Social & Emotional Skills

Daycare centers help infants and toddlers develop social and emotional skills as they are introduced to diverse peers from various ages and backgrounds. This environment allows them to engage in different social interactions, such as group activities and games, where children practice and learn about conflict resolution and teamwork.


Becoming Independent

When attending a private kindergarten, infants, and toddlers explore a new environment away from home that encourages them to be independent. Even though teachers guide and care for students, they are free to create their own activities and try new things. This autonomous setting positively impacts their behavior, leading to high self-confidence and excellent decision-making.


Boosting Health

Child care facilities promote healthy habits and develop a strong immune system. Even though daycares have strict cleaning policies, infants and toddlers are most likely to encounter germs that help them develop antibodies that protect them from future sicknesses. Additionally, facilities cook different meals that encourage children to try new vegetables, fruits, and other foods.
